应用开发过程中如何保证代码质量?
在当今快速发展的互联网时代,应用开发已经成为企业竞争的重要手段。然而,随着应用数量的激增,如何保证代码质量成为开发者面临的一大挑战。本文将深入探讨应用开发过程中保证代码质量的方法,旨在为开发者提供有益的参考。
一、明确需求,规划合理
明确需求是保证代码质量的第一步。在项目启动阶段,开发团队需要与客户充分沟通,确保对需求的理解准确无误。以下是一些关键点:
- 需求文档:编写清晰、详细的需求文档,包括功能描述、性能指标、界面设计等。
- 原型设计:制作原型,让客户直观地了解应用的功能和界面。
- 评审会议:定期召开评审会议,确保需求的一致性和准确性。
规划合理是保证代码质量的关键。在项目开发过程中,要合理分配任务,明确各阶段的目标和验收标准。
二、采用敏捷开发,提高代码质量
敏捷开发是一种以人为核心、迭代、循序渐进的开发方法。它有助于提高代码质量,具体体现在以下几个方面:
- 持续集成:通过自动化测试和持续集成工具,及时发现并修复代码缺陷。
- 代码审查:定期进行代码审查,确保代码符合规范,提高代码质量。
- 重构:在项目开发过程中,不断重构代码,提高代码的可读性和可维护性。
三、编写高质量的代码
编写高质量的代码是保证应用质量的基础。以下是一些关键点:
- 编码规范:制定统一的编码规范,包括命名规则、缩进、注释等。
- 代码风格:保持代码风格一致,提高代码可读性。
- 注释:为代码添加必要的注释,方便他人理解和维护。
- 单元测试:编写单元测试,确保代码功能的正确性。
四、优化性能,提高用户体验
优化性能是保证应用质量的重要环节。以下是一些性能优化方法:
- 代码优化:对代码进行优化,减少不必要的计算和内存占用。
- 数据库优化:优化数据库查询,提高数据访问速度。
- 缓存:使用缓存技术,减少数据库访问次数,提高应用性能。
五、持续学习和交流
持续学习是提高自身技能的重要途径。开发者应关注行业动态,学习新技术、新工具,不断提高自己的技术水平。
交流也是保证代码质量的重要手段。通过与其他开发者的交流,可以学习到他人的经验和教训,提高自己的代码质量。
案例分析:
某互联网公司开发了一款在线教育平台,由于前期需求不明确,导致开发过程中频繁修改代码,最终影响了项目进度和质量。后来,公司调整了开发策略,明确了需求,采用了敏捷开发模式,并加强了对代码的审查和优化,最终成功上线,赢得了良好的口碑。
总结:
保证应用开发过程中的代码质量需要从多个方面入手,包括明确需求、规划合理、采用敏捷开发、编写高质量的代码、优化性能和持续学习等。只有不断提高代码质量,才能为企业创造更大的价值。
猜你喜欢:云网监控平台